Maumee, OH (December 15, 2024) – An accident with injuries was reported on I-475 S near W Dussel Dr in Maumee on Sunday. Emergency responders arrived at the scene following reports of the crash.
Initial information indicates that multiple individuals were involved, with at least one person sustaining injuries. Emergency crews provided medical care at the scene, and one or more injured individuals were transported to a nearby hospital for further evaluation and treatment. The exact number of injured parties and their conditions have not been released.
Traffic along I-475 S was significantly impacted as responders worked to clear the roadway and investigate the cause of the crash. Further updates may be provided as more details become available.

Highway Accidents in Ohio
Highway accidents, like the one at I-475 S and W Dussel Dr, are a frequent occurrence in Ohio due to high traffic volumes and higher speeds. Common contributing factors include distracted driving, sudden lane changes, and failure to maintain safe distances, which can lead to severe injuries and property damage.
Victims of highway accidents are advised to seek immediate medical attention and document the details of the crash thoroughly. Filing an official police report, collecting witness accounts, and taking photographs of the scene are critical steps for ensuring proper handling of insurance claims or potential legal actions.
Ohio continues its efforts to improve highway safety through public education campaigns and infrastructure enhancements. Drivers are urged to exercise caution, adhere to speed limits, and maintain attentiveness, especially on busy roadways.
